A site is a software package deal. By definition, a bundle is a ready-made program that can be found to users for use to execute some responsibilities. These users include non-IT professionals. Thus, a site meets your criteria to be a bundle like Microsoft Office, Peachtree Accounting packages. dr
Before the revolution of The Internet (WWW), advancement software package deal was the exclusive keep of skillful programmers. Developers or software developers develop the logic of programs which a package will eventually use to function. This logic building aspect of software development requires high level of mind. This together with the intricacies of mastering development languages made the development of packages uninteresting and unattractive to a sizable range of people.
Following the revolution of The Internet, it became feasible for non-programmers to develop packages from the inception. These are web-based packages and of course, web sites, necessitating no programming skills. The end result was the creation of a new type of career called Website development. A web designer is somebody who organizes a web web page by arranging texts, pictures, animations, forms etc on a page and forms them to produce good presentation. All he needs do is to use any of the appropriate web design tools like Macromedia Visual Studio and Ms FrontPage. Throughout the Style section of Macromedia Dreamweaver, for example, you can design a whole web page without using HTML CODE codes. What you have is a web site. A internet site is more than one web pages. These web development tools are the comparative of the actual popular deal Adobe PageMaker does which is to organize and format pages of catalogs, magazines, newspapers etc. Zero programming is required.
Thus, it probably is possible to develop dynamic and online web sites capable of accomplishing what conventional software could do on stand-alone computer and network using non-internet technologies. Online banking, stock broking are examples. These types of functions can now be carried out totally on internet. To develop efficient scripts for such robotic tasks, logic building and mastery of the development language to use in conditions of syntax are required. Most of the programs are written from scratch.
Can you be an internet designer and a web programmer? Yes, you can. You will discover people who double as web developer and web programmer but specialists are noted for doing better in their respective fields of field of expertise than non-specialists. Some sites do not require more than web designing but many sites nowadays require both web designing and web programming like the multi-tier applications which may have demonstration layer, the logic level that interfaces the demonstration layer with the data source, and the data part made up of the database. Right now there are even database specialists who design database and write what is called stored procedures and sparks right inside the databases. The use of stored procedures enhances the overall efficiency of site execution as it minimizes the quantity of times SQL assertions are parsed, compiled, and optimized during execution. You can view that site development is quite deep.
The functions of web designers and web programmers are supporting in the development of web site. You need to identify where your ability lies and allow that to inform selecting an area of specialization. If you know you have the ability to write programs, you can go further than web designing and become a web programmer but if it is normally, stick to web building and continue to expand and sharpen your skills. The truth of the matter is that coding is not for everyone.
If you are a conventional graphic artist, you will find it easy to crossover to web designing and if you are a conventional designer, you can readily all terain to web programming. What I mean by regular graphic artists are those who have the competence in the use of tools like CorelDraw, Photoshop, and PageMaker to perform Desktop Publishing tasks. Simply by conventional programmers, I am talking about the experts in programming different languages like C++, FoxPro, COBOL, and Dbase.